*{margin:0;padding:0;font-family:Tahoma;}
body {margin:0;padding:0;background-color:#001F46;color:#FFF;}
.header{background:url('imag/bgt.jpg') repeat-x;border-top-left-radius:8px;border-top-right-radius:8px;height:27px;}
.foote{background:url('imag/bgbd.jpg') repeat-x;border-bottom-left-radius:8px;border-bottom-right-radius:8px;height:27px;}

#bgh {height:168px; margin:0;background:url('bgh.jpg') repeat-x center top}
#headcontainer, #footcontainer {margin: 0px auto; position: relative; z-index: 2;}
#headcontainer {width:998px; height:168px;}
#hp1, #hp2, #hp3, #hp4, #hp5, #hp6, #hp7 {height:168px; float:left}
#hp1 {width:76px}
#hp2 {width:161px}
#hp3 {width:155px}
#hp4 {width:140px}
#hp5 {width:141px}
#hp6, #hp6a, #hp6b {width:265px; float:left}
#hp6a {height:24px}
#hp6b {height:144px}
#hp7 {width:60px}

#smalltop {
	position: absolute;
	top:35px;
	right: 87px;
	width: 206px;
	height: 113px;
}
.smtop {
	font-family: Tahoma;
	font-size:13px;
	color:#FFD55C;
	font-weight: bold;
	text-align: left;
}
.smtop a{
	font-size:13px;
	color:#FFFFFF;
	text-decoration:none;
	font-weight: normal;
}
.smtop a:hover{
	color:#9ABEF0;
	text-decoration:underline;
}

#bgf {
	height:100px;
	background: url(bgf.jpg) repeat-x center top;
	position: relative;
}
#footcontainer {width:900px; height:100px;}
#fp1, #fp2 {height:100px; float:left;}
#fp1 {width:297px;}
#fp2 {width:603px;}
#footxt {
	position: absolute;
	top:12px;
	right: 41px;
	width: 556px;
	height: 79px;
	text-align:left;
}
.textup {
	color: #FFFFFF;
	font-size: 12px;
}
.textup a{
	text-decoration: underline;
	font-size: 14px;
	color: #FFFFFF;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
}
.textup a:hover{color: #FCD55E; text-decoration: none;}

.paginator{
        padding-top:3px;
}
.arc a{
	color:#FFFFFF;
	border:1px solid;
	padding:1px 10px;
	text-align:center;
	text-decoration:none;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:700;
	font-size:12px;
	border-color:#72B8F4;
	line-height: 15px;
	background-color: #1864D4;
}
.arc A:hover{
	color:#FFFFFF;
	border-color:#40A426;
	background-color: #3D9429;
}
.btl {
	FONT-WEIGHT: bold;
	font-family: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#ffffff;
	float:left;
	line-height: 24px;
}

.blocktitle{
	color:#FFFFFF;
	font-size:18px;
	font-weight:bold;
}
.blocktitle a{
	color: #FFFF99;
	text-decoration: none;
}
.blocktitle a:hover{
	color: #3FD4FC;
	text-decoration: underline;
}

.lefttop .top {width:155px; padding: 0px; float:left;}
.lefttop .top li {
	color: #000000;
	font-style: normal;
	text-indent:7px;
	text-align:left;
	background-color: #1E822C;
	border-left: 5px solid;
	border-left-color: #FDD55C;
	overflow: hidden;
	border-bottom: 1px dotted;
	background:url(bg_li.jpg) repeat-y left;
	list-style: none;
}
.lefttop .top a{
	color:#FFFFFF;
	font-size:11px;
	text-decoration:none;
	font-weight:bold;
	line-height: 15px;
	font-family: Tahoma;
}
.lefttop .top a:hover{
	color: #FED559;
	text-decoration: underline;
	font-weight: bold;
}

.t {
	display: inline;
	position: relative;
	margin-left: -2px;
}

.t a {
	display: inline-block;
	height: 205px;
	margin: 3px;
	position: relative;
	text-decoration: none;
	width: 240px;
	text-align: center;
	color: #FFD65E;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
}
.t b{
	color: #FFFFFF;
	text-decoration: none;
	font-size: 16px;
	font-family: Arial, Helvetica, sans-serif;
	font-weight: bold;
}
.t b:hover{
	color: #B9DBF7;
	text-decoration: underline;

}
.t img{
	margin: 0px;
	border: 1px solid;
	padding: 1px;
	left: 0px;
	border-color: #FFFFFF;
}

div.pb {
    position: absolute;
    left: 1px;
    top: 1px;
    text-decoration: none;
}
.text {
	font-weight: bold;
	font-size:12px;
	color:#FED65D;
}
.text a{
	font-size:12px;
	color:#FFFFFF;
	text-decoration:none;
	font-family: Tahoma;
}
.text a:hover{
	color:#FFD75E;
	text-decoration:underline;
}

.mainbody {position:relative;max-width:1260px;}
ul.thumbs{list-style:none;font-size:0;margin:auto auto;background-color:#000;padding-top:5px;}
ul.thumbs li{display:inline-block;}
.thumb {display:inline-block;width:303px;margin-right:5px;margin-bottom:5px;}
.thumb a {text-decoration:none;text-align:left;}
.thumb img {border:1px solid #fff;color:#FFF;}
.thumb div.title {
	display:block;
	font-size:13px;
	line-height:17px;
	color: #FFFFFF;
	overflow:hidden;
	text-align:center;
	background-image: url('tbg.jpg');
	background-repeat:repeat-x;
	font-family: Tahoma;
	white-space: nowrap;
}
.thumb:hover img {border:1px solid orange;}
.thumb a:hover div.title {color:#FFF;background-image:url('tbg2.jpg');background-repeat:repeat-x;text-decoration:none;}
.thumb b {
	position:absolute;
	height:16px;
	margin:0 1px 0 1px;
	padding:0 1px 0 1px;
	background-color:#000;
	text-align:center;
	left: 4px;
	top: 3px;
	color: #FFF;
	font-size: 12px;
}

.tags a{color:#FED65D;font-size: 15px;line-height:18px;font-family: Arial, Helvetica, sans-serif;text-decoration:none;}
.categ{display:inline-block;width:235px;text-align:left;color: #FFF;margin: 3px;font-size:11px;}

.nsg_play{overflow:invden;margin-bottom:10px;position:relative;height:480px;width:640px}.nsg_play inv{position:relative;background:#f0f0f0}.nsg_play.mac:before{top:0;bottom:81px;left:0;right:348px}.nsg_play.mac:after{top:0;bottom:27px;left:608px;right:0}.nsg_play.mac>i:before{top:0;bottom:81px;left:348px;right:61px}.nsg_play.mac>i:after{top:0;bottom:281px;left:0;right:0}.nsg_play.mac>i>b:before{top:399px;bottom:27px;left:0;right:297px}.nsg_play.mac>i>b:after{top:0;bottom:99px;left:500px;right:0}.nsg_play.mac>i>b>i:before{top:399px;bottom:27px;left:421px;right:61px}.nsg_play.mac>i>b>i:after{top:429px;bottom:27px;left:0;right:200px}.nsg_play.mac>i>b>i>b:before{top:255px;bottom:81px;left:292px;right:292px}.nsg_play.mac>i>b>i>b>i:before{top:0;bottom:454px;left:0;right:0;content:''}.nsg_play.mac>i>b>i>b>i:after{top:434px;bottom:27px;left:0;right:538px;content:'AnalnoePorno.net';font-size:11px;padding-left:7px;color:orange}.nsg_play.mac:before,.nsg_play.mac:after,.nsg_play.mac>i:before,.nsg_play.mac>i:after,.nsg_play.mac>i>b:before,.nsg_play.mac>i>b:after,.nsg_play.mac>i>b>i:before,.nsg_play.mac>i>b>i:after,.nsg_play.mac>i>b>i>b:before{content:'';display:block;background-color:transparent;position:absolute}.nsg_play.mac>i>b>i>b>i:before,.nsg_play.mac>i>b>i>b>i:after{display:block;background-color:#000;position:absolute}
.block1 table{spacing:0;border:0;cellpadding:0;cellspacing:0;padding:0;}
.block1 table td{spacing:0;border:0;cellpadding:0;cellspacing:0;padding:0;}
